Karl Alomar is a Series A investor at M13 in New York focused on Software and Internet. Karl Alomar is based out of Miami Beach, Florida and is the Managing Partner of M13 and Board of Directors of Teleskope. Karl previously worked at DigitalOcean as a Chief Operating Officer. Karl Alomar attended Columbia Business School.

About M13
M13 provides strategic counsel and operational expertise to help founders grow their companies. Through Fund II, M13 will expand its focus to emerging technologies driving change in consumer behavior over the next decade. Founded in 2016 with offices in Los Angeles, New York, and San Francisco.
